The prize purse for the 2023 Arnold Classic was raised to $300,000, which encouraged some competitors to enter. Nick Walker, who had placed third at the Olympia, was one of the additions. Despite being a favorite going into the Arnold Classic, he ended up placing behind Samson Dauda. After the event, Walker shared an Instagram story asking fans not to attack the judges or other competitors. He also revealed that he had not initially planned to compete in the Arnold Classic but decided to participate once the prize money was raised and he was asked.

Flex Wheeler, a former professional bodybuilder, recently appeared on OlympiaTV and shared his thoughts on Samson Dauda’s performance at the 2023 Arnold Classic. According to Wheeler, he believed that Dauda was the winner of the competition from the moment he stepped on stage. He also mentioned that he was impressed by Dauda’s full physique and the way he highlighted the weaknesses of his competitors.
Andrew Jacked, another competitor at the 2023 Arnold Classic, had some experience in the festival and had previously won the Arnold Classic UK in 2022. Despite being considered a dark horse, Jacked was able to impress many with his performance. However, according to Wheeler, he was still not able to beat Samson Dauda, who was the clear winner of the competition. Wheeler believed that Jacked’s balance and look were better than in his previous show, but Dauda’s beautiful physique, added muscle mass, and conditioning made him stand out and take home the top prize.
Flex Wheeler also commented on Nick Walker’s performance at the 2023 Arnold Classic. Despite being considered a favorite coming into the show, Walker fell short on stage, placing second. There were talks about his lower body following the show, and Wheeler touched on this area. He questioned whether having a stronger lower body would have made a difference in the outcome of the competition, implying that Dauda’s overall package was superior.
